  • peragogoperagogo Posts: 223 Member
    I don’t really think the last few packs have really had the need for a new skill. Strangerville was more of a mystery, Island Living reworked swimming with the fitness skill, Moschino added a tripod to photography and Realm of Magic has a rank system. Adding skills wouldn’t have really worked as well.

  • SimmervilleSimmerville Posts: 11,644 Member
    I don't need many more skills, really. So I have not missed more additions. The only kind of skill I've missed is when sims grow up and I think they will suit some sort of office career, I wish there was more than Logic (+ Charisma) to prepare them. I miss som,e kind of Economics skill, which could both relay towards business/politics and household/shopping. It feels weird that the CEO of my local bank will get the job thanks to playing chess, lol. Also miss TS2's cleaning skill, but it's a minor thing and perhaps it's already in the game as a hidden skill.
